Escalation: the Wrenfield color-contrast audit runs nightly against staging and files tickets automatically. If it starts failing builds (not just warning), that usually means someone bumped the contrast threshold in the Palette config — check recent commits there first. Don't just disable the check to unblock a release; that needs sign-off from the accessibility lead. If you're stuck or need an exception fast, ping the audit owners below.

escalation mailbox, badug-tawip: ulaath@nelvroforge.example

Subject: Flaky tests handoff — welcome aboard!

Hi folks, since a few of you just joined the Tollgate payments team: the flaky integration tests in the settlement suite have been a long-running headache, mostly timing issues against the sandbox ledger. I'm stepping back to focus on reconciliation work, so the flake triage duty now belongs to the teammate named below.

named custodian: Brivan Eliath Quenox Frador

**Ticket PRX-creds: Expired credentials for pricing experiment**

The Faremix ticket-pricing experiment stopped serving variants last night because the shared key for the internal Tariffline service expired. Plugin authors: any plugin calling Tariffline directly needs the replacement key before Thursday's traffic split resumes. No code changes are required, just a config update. The replacement key is below.

gateway credential: kto3_qfe